Understanding Sexual Health and Well-being

Sexual health and its role in relationships

Sexual health encompasses more than just the absence of disease; it encompasses physical, emotional, and psychological aspects of an individual’s sexuality. 

In the context of relationships, sexual well-being involves the ability to have pleasurable and satisfying sexual experiences that are consensual, respectful, and free from coercion.

Physical, emotional, and psychological aspects of sexual well-being.

Physically, sexual well-being involves maintaining good sexual health through regular check-ups, practicing safe sex, and addressing any potential medical concerns. 

Emotionally, it involves cultivating a positive body image, embracing sexual desires and preferences, and fostering open communication with one’s partner. 

Psychologically, sexual well-being encompasses the ability to experience desire, pleasure, and satisfaction, as well as addressing any emotional barriers or traumas that may impact one’s sexual experiences.

Sign of a Healthy Sex Life: Effective Communication in Sexual Relationships

A healthy and fulfilling sex life thrives on open and honest communication between partners. It is essential to create an environment where both individuals feel safe and comfortable expressing their desires, boundaries, and expectations. 

By openly discussing these aspects, partners can better understand each other’s needs and work together to ensure mutual satisfaction.

Open communication about sexual preferences is crucial in fostering a satisfying sexual relationship. By sharing desires and fantasies, partners can explore new experiences together and cultivate a sense of adventure. 

This openness allows for a deeper understanding of each other’s wants and allows the relationship to evolve and grow.

However, effective communication in sexual relationships may face challenges. Communication barriers can arise from various factors, such as discomfort, past experiences, or societal conditioning. 

Overcoming these barriers requires patience, empathy, and a willingness to create a safe and non-judgmental space for open dialogue. By actively listening to each other’s concerns and being receptive to feedback, partners can build trust and strengthen their connection.

Building Trust and Intimacy in Sexual Relationships

Trust is the foundation of any healthy sexual relationship. Establishing trust requires emotional vulnerability and mutual respect. 

By creating a safe space where partners feel comfortable expressing their desires and boundaries without fear of judgment or rejection, trust can flourish. 

Honesty, reliability, and keeping promises contribute to building trust and fostering a sense of security within the loving relationship.

Intimacy goes beyond the physical aspects of a sexual relationship. It involves emotional connection, deepening the bond between partners. 

Emotional intimacy can be nurtured through acts of affection, such as cuddling, holding hands, or engaging in meaningful conversations about desires, dreams, and fears. These acts build a sense of closeness and deepen the emotional connection.

To deepen trust and intimacy, partners can explore various strategies. This may involve trying new sexual experiences together, such as role-playing, sensual massages, or incorporating sex toys. 

Exploring and discussing boundaries, fantasies, and experimenting with consented activities can lead to a deeper understanding of each other’s desires and foster a stronger bond.

It is important to note that building trust and intimacy in a sexual relationship is an ongoing process that requires patience, effort, and continuous communication. 

Both partners should actively work towards creating a safe, supportive, and respectful environment that nurtures trust and intimacy.

Exploring Sexual Compatibility and Variety

A healthy and fulfilling sexual relationship goes hand in hand with sexual compatibility, which encompasses the alignment of desires, preferences, and needs between partners.

Understanding and addressing sexual compatibility play a crucial role in fostering a satisfying and harmonious relationship.

It requires open and honest conversations about sexual needs, expectations, and desires to ensure both partners are on the same page. 

By developing a deep understanding of each other’s sexual wants and needs, couples can establish a strong foundation for sexual satisfaction and create an environment where both individuals feel seen, valued, and fulfilled in their sexual expression.

Variety and novelty are vital elements in maintaining sexual satisfaction and preventing monotony in a long-term intimate relationship. 

Exploring new experiences together can add excitement, adventure, and intimacy to the sexual relationship. This may involve trying different sexual positions, incorporating role-play or fantasies, or introducing new settings and locations. 

It is important to approach these explorations with consent, open-mindedness, and respect for each other’s boundaries. 

By embracing variety, couples can discover new dimensions of pleasure, deepen their connection, and keep the flame of desire alive.

Overcoming Challenges and Common Relationship Issues

Challenges are a natural part of any healthy relationship, including the sexual aspect. Mismatched libidos, differing sexual preferences, or sexual dysfunctions can create obstacles to sexual satisfaction. 

It is crucial for partners to approach these challenges as a team, communicating openly and compassionately about concerns and seeking solutions together. 

By fostering an environment of trust, understanding, and empathy, couples can work through challenges, find ways to meet each other’s needs, and achieve intimacy for each other again. 

Seeking professional help, such as couples therapy or consulting professional sex therapists, can provide valuable guidance and support in navigating these challenges, helping couples regain their sexual well-being, re-establish physical intimacy and enhance their overall relationship.

Sexual Empowerment and Consent

Sexual empowerment and consent are essential aspects of a healthy and fulfilling sexual relationship. It is crucial to create an environment where individuals feel empowered to assert their boundaries, communicate their desires, and have their needs met with respect and understanding.

Empowering Individuals to Assert Boundaries and Express Desires

In a sexually empowering relationship, individuals are encouraged to assert their boundaries and communicate their desires openly and honestly. This requires active listening, non-judgmental support, and a willingness to engage in ongoing dialogue about sexual preferences and needs. When both partners feel empowered to express themselves, it cultivates a sense of agency and contributes to a mutually satisfying sexual relationship.

The Importance of Consent and Enthusiastic Participation

Consent is the cornerstone of healthy sexual interactions. It is vital to emphasize the importance of obtaining clear and enthusiastic consent from all parties involved in any sexual activity. This includes ongoing communication and checking in with each other to ensure that consent is present throughout the sexual experience. By prioritizing consent, individuals can create a safe and respectful environment that fosters trust, intimacy, and pleasure.

Fostering a Culture of Consent and Mutual Respect

Creating a culture of consent and mutual respect involves promoting open discussions about consent, boundaries, and sexual expectations. It also requires challenging societal norms and beliefs that perpetuate harmful attitudes towards consent. By educating oneself and others, supporting survivor-centered initiatives, and promoting positive sexual communication, individuals can contribute to a broader culture that values consent and respect in all sexual interactions.
